Recombinant Anti-NRP2 Vesicular Antibody, EV Displayed (VS-0425-YC360) (CAT#: VS-0425-YC360)
The Recombinant Anti-NRP2 Vesicular Antibody, EV Displayed (VS-0425-YC360) is an antibody-displaying extracellular vesicle (Ab-EV). The product combines the benefits of both extracellular vesicle (EV) and antibody (Ab) which can guide the decorated EVs to NRP2-expressed cells or tissues. The NRP2 is a receptor protein involved in cardiovascular development and axon guidance, interacting with VEGF and semaphorins.

- Introduction
- This gene encodes a member of the neuropilin family of receptor proteins. The encoded transmembrane protein binds to SEMA3C protein {sema domain, immunoglobulin domain (Ig), short basic domain, secreted, (semaphorin) 3C} and SEMA3F protein {sema domain, immunoglobulin domain (Ig), short basic domain, secreted, (semaphorin) 3F}, and interacts with vascular endothelial growth factor (VEGF). This protein may play a role in cardiovascular development, axon guidance, and tumorigenesis. Multiple transcript variants encoding distinct isoforms have been identified for this gene.
